Runbook: GateCount turnstile counter, Harrowfield Stadium. If lane totals drift from the ops dashboard, first check the edge collector on the concourse switch — it buffers during network blips and replays late. Don't reset counters mid-event; reconcile after close instead. When filing a drift report, include the collector's trace token shown below.

session token of tajef-bageg = htk21_5d90d574934f3ccae6437

Subject: Pickwise 4.1 released to all warehouses

Team,

Pickwise 4.1 is now live across the Tarnfield and Osset distribution sites. This release reworks the pick-list optimizer to batch aisles by congestion score rather than raw distance, which cut average walk time about 8% in trials. Rollback images for 4.0 remain on the Hollis registry for two weeks. If you need to correlate warehouse reports with this deploy, reference the build token appended below.

build token for fajof-yahof: htk4_869f

Facilities Ticket — Cleaning Crew Access, Brindle Annex

For new starters handling evening lock-up: the Sorano Cleaning crew arrives nightly at 21:30 via the annex side door. Check their rota sheet, note arrival in the log, and ensure the storeroom is relocked afterward. To let them through the side door, enter the access code below.

badge for yaweg-hafog: bdg-GX-6